Lew Ayres

About

American actor and musician whose film and television career spanned 65 years.

Born December 28, 1908 in Minneapolis, Minnesota.
Died December 30, 1996 (aged 88) in Los Angeles, California.
He was married to singer/actress Lola Lane of the Lane sisters (1931-33, divorce) and Ginger Rogers (1934-40, divorce).

Before pursing acting full-time, he played banjo and guitar for big bands, including the Henry Halstead Orchestra. His instruments were tenor banjo, long-neck banjo and guitar.
His leading role in the original version of All Quiet on the Western Front (1930) that made him a star. He was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Actor for his performance in Johnny Belinda (1948). He also directed and produced a few films.
